James Gaymer Jones was born at Upper Norwood, London, on 26 August 1891. His father was also an MRCS. Born 19 November 1893 at Liskeard, Cornwall, the third child and second son of William Huddy, silversmith, and Jessie Ham, his wife. John Gilmour, the eldest of the three children of the Rev. James Gilmour, a Presbyterian minister, and of Annie Campbell (née Brown), was born in Cowdenbeath, Fife, Scotland, on 1 December 1893. Leslie Herbert Worthy Williams was born at Newport, Monmouthshire on 27 February 1893, the son of the late Mr T Gill Williams and Mrs Williams (née Willey).
